In their code of ethics, it is stated that nurses’ role in healthcare is to provide optimal care and to help in promoting and protecting the safety and health of patients. 2013 article by the Patient Safety America, Houston, Texas puts the number of deaths “associated with preventable harm in hospitals” at around 400,000 per year. 2010 study published by PubMed Central® has found that several measures may be effective in reducing nursing errors, including fostering an environment in which nurses could easily admit to committed lapses, so that immediate resolution may be implemented.
